The GreatSchools Rating helps parents compare schools within a state based on a variety of school quality indicators and provides a helpful picture of how effectively each school serves all of its students. Ratings are on a scale of 1 (below average) to 10 (above average) and can include test scores, college readiness, academic progress, advanced courses, equity, discipline and attendance data. We also advise parents to visit schools, consider other information on school performance and programs, and consider family needs as part of the school selection process.

Viburnum High School is a public school for students in grades 6-12 in Viburnum, MO and is served by the Iron County C-IV School District in Missouri. Annual tuition is $0. The school has a total enrollment of 191 and maintains a student-teacher ratio of 13:1. Academic records show that 37% of students achieve proficiency in math, and 32% are proficient in reading. Viburnum High School has received feedback and ratings, with a Niche grade of C+ and a GreatSchools Rating of 4 out of 10. The average GPA is 3.51, the graduation rate is 90%, and the average ACT score is 23. Discover additional schools in the area, like Viburnum Elementary School, and more.
